Enhancing Your Plastic Injection Molding Process
Achieving optimal performance in your plastic injection molding operations involves a multifaceted approach. It's crucial to carefully analyze every stage of the process, from material selection and mold design to processing parameters and quality control. By adopting best practices and exploiting advanced technologies, you can significantly improve cycle times, reduce defects, and elevate the overall standard of your finished products.
- Consider material properties carefully to ensure compatibility with your desired application.
- Fine-tune processing parameters such as injection pressure, temperature, and cooling time to achieve the perfect melt flow and solidification characteristics.
- Implement a robust quality control system to inspect critical dimensions and guarantee product consistency.

Choosing the Right Plastic Injection Molding Machine for Your Needs
Plastic injection molding presents a popular manufacturing process for creating diverse plastic products. , Consequently, selecting the right machine to your specific needs require careful consideration. Several factors influence this decision, including the nature of product you're manufacturing, production volume, and material . specifications.
Assess website your output needs. Large-scale production necessitates a machine with powerful clamping and rapid cycling speeds. Conversely, Limited production might benefit from a more versatile machine that can manage a spectrum of product sizes and materials.
, Moreover, the type of plastic you're using has a role in choosing the appropriate machine. Different plastics have unique melting points, viscosities, and handling requirements.
